Transaction 7562fa52196ad447e688e704fcc4767ee1962c5395ce0503d2c8ce5f7eb9561a

2 Input
2 Outputs
  • 7562fa52196ad447e688e704fcc4767ee1962c5395ce0503d2c8ce5f7eb9561a:0
  • value  50000
    address  2NA6umNrb57TCGGN2cj49sSdW5SzpcVaqYB
  • 7562fa52196ad447e688e704fcc4767ee1962c5395ce0503d2c8ce5f7eb9561a:1
  • value  1037111
    address  2N7wz7JEkG2ioABAaiz5diYMZ9AtdrGsk1F